Raila recognises Uhuru as President in surprise statement

Odinga had previously stated he would not recognise Kenyatta's presidency

On Tuesday, during an interview with Citizen TV, the former Prime Minister referred to Kenyatta as President despite his previous public statement that he would not recognise him.

“I have no issue with the President as a person, we have a relationship as families…We have a long history,” the NASA leader stated.

The tense interview, held at the Jaramogi Mausoleum, begun with one of Odinga’s granddaughters asking him if he is still friends with President Kenyatta.

“That is grandpa Oburu with Uhuru Kenyatta?” the granddaughter asks, to which Odinga responds, “Yes, Uhuru came here”.

The young girl innocently asks, “You are still friends?”

The Opposition leader replies in the affirmative even as the innocent girl remains sceptical of his response.

“Even now you are friends? …aii” she remarks as they move on to another subject.

The two leaders have had a protracted political rivalry, with the Opposition chief stating that he would swear himself in as President, unless Kenyatta agrees to a dialogue process.
